Minister issues notice to Secy 

By Our Staff Reporter

Bhopal, Apr 30: Madhya Pradesh Food, Civil Supplies and Consumer Protection Minister Akhand Pratap Singh Yadav today sought an immediate clarification from Secretary KP Singh on a circular to collectors for gathering crowds of 25,000 people at each function coinciding with the launch of the 'Mukhyamantri Annapurna Yojana' in this state.

In a notice to the bureaucrat, the Minister sought to know under whose order the circular was issued. ''I was not provided any information in this regard to this day,'' Yadav said.

The minister, who is fasting at Chhatarpur district headquarters as part of a statewide agitation against the Centre's ''stepmotherly'' attitude, said on telephone that he learnt of the April 10 circular today - when a copy was brought before him - and strict action would be taken against the official if his reply was not satisfactory.

A copy of the notice was released to the local press today. The Yojana, launched on April 26, envisages wheat at Rs 3 per kg and rice at Rs 4.5 per kg to the poor, subject to a maximum monthly limit. For formal launching, customer awareness camps were organised at various district headquarters on April 27, 28 and 29 and attended by Bharatiya Janata Party-ruled states' chief ministers, ministers and other leaders.
